Math tutors in Clearwater for building skills through step-by-step structure

Clearwater blends coastal life with steady academic effort. Tutors help students see math as a process built through small, clear steps. Across the Pinellas County Schools District, structured routines guide learners toward stronger foundations and greater confidence.

Step 1: Begin with clear learning goals

Progress starts with knowing what to focus on. Tutors help students set one small goal before each session. At Oak Grove Middle School, tutors encourage learners to write down simple targets such as reviewing equations or improving accuracy. This planning helps students stay organized and confident. When sessions begin with purpose, students avoid drifting between topics and make more meaningful progress.

Step 2: Strengthen early foundations

Many challenges in higher math appear when basic concepts feel unsteady. At Skycrest Elementary School, warmup exercises help identify which skills need review. Tutors encourage students to revisit operations, number relationships, and simple equations. Study spaces at the Clearwater Main Library support quiet, focused practice. Strengthening basics prepares students for algebra and geometry and prevents confusion during advanced chapters.

Step 3: Break assignments into manageable parts

Large assignments often feel overwhelming. Tutors teach learners to divide work into smaller pieces that are easier to complete. At Clearwater High School, practice is organized into short intervals so students can pause and check understanding. Programs at the Countryside Library reinforce this pacing and help students stay focused. Breaking tasks down increases accuracy and makes studying more comfortable.

Step 4: Connect math to real-life examples

Math feels clearer when students see how it fits into daily life. Tutors introduce examples involving measurement, schedules, and comparisons. At Dunedin Highland Middle School, students apply formulas to familiar tasks such as estimating distances or planning small projects. Sessions at St. Petersburg College Clearwater Campus show how math supports healthcare, business, and technology programs. These connections increase motivation and help students understand each concept’s purpose.

Step 5: Talk through reasoning out loud

Speaking through steps helps clarify ideas. Tutors encourage learners to explain each part of a solution. Study groups provide opportunities to compare methods and hear different approaches. At Safety Harbor Middle School, collaborative activities build communication skills and strengthen problem solving. Talking through reasoning helps students understand what they know and where confusion begins.

Step 6: Learn from mistakes through reflection

Mistakes offer important information. Instead of moving on quickly, tutors help students slow down and review each error. Learners keep short notes describing what caused mistakes and how they fixed them. Programs at the Clearwater East Community Center guide students to revisit earlier problems to see patterns. Reflection reduces repeated errors and builds a stronger understanding of concepts.

Step 7: Explore multiple solution paths

Math often has more than one correct method. Tutors encourage students to compare strategies to increase flexibility. At Dunedin Elementary School, class activities show learners how different approaches lead to the same answer. Understanding multiple paths helps students stay calm when facing unfamiliar problems.

Step 8: See how math connects to future opportunities

Motivation grows when students see how math supports real careers. Employers such as BayCare Health System use math for planning and reviewing data. These examples help students appreciate how reasoning applies beyond school.
